Contact Details of Rambala Auto Agency


78, Chunambukara Street,
Near Hotel Palace,
Katpadi Road,
Vellore - 632004, Tamil Nadu , India
Phone Number: (0416) 2222923, (0416) , 0NULL

Product & Services of Rambala Auto Agency

Main Business
Automobile Parts & Equipment Dealers
Services
Automobile Parts & Equipment Dealers Related All Services
Products
Two Wheeler Spare Parts